areola
(ă-rē′ŏ-lă)
(ă-rē′ŏ-lē″)
pl. areolae [L. areola, a small space]
1. A small space or cavity in a tissue.
2. A circular area of different pigmentation, as around a wheal, around the nipple of the breast, or the part of the iris around the pupil.
areolar (ă-rē′ŏ-lăr), adj.

areola mammae
The pigmented area surrounding the nipple, onto which multiple sebaceous glands (areolar glands) open.

second areola
A pigmented area surrounding the areola mammae during pregnancy.
areola umbilicalis
A pigmented area surrounding the umbilicus.
